Care and Considerations for Lined Clogs
Maintaining the appearance and comfort of lined clogs requires attention to specific care instructions. Proper cleaning and storage ensure longevity and continued enjoyment of these footwear items.
Tip 1: Cleaning the Exterior: Surface dirt and debris can be removed using a damp cloth or sponge. Avoid har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, which may damage the outer material.
Tip 2: Caring for the Lining: The plush lining requires gentle care. Spot cleaning with a mild detergent and cool water is recommended. Avoid fully submerging the footwear in water.
Tip 3: Drying: Allow the footwear to air dry completely after cleaning. Avoid direct heat or sunlight, which can cause shrinkage or discoloration of the materials.
Tip 4: Storage: Store lined clogs in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and moisture. Stuffing the footwear with tissue paper can help maintain its shape during storage.
Tip 5: Addressing Odor: Periodically sprinkle baking soda inside the footwear to absorb moisture and neutralize odors. Allow the baking soda to sit for several hours before removing.
Following these guidelines will ensure the long-lasting comfort and aesthetic appeal of lined clogs. Proper care preserves the integrity of both the exterior and the delicate lining, maximizing the lifespan of the footwear.

Frequently Asked Questions
This section addresses common inquiries regarding clogs lined with faux fur, often referred to as “teddy bear” style.
Question 1: Are lined clogs suitable for outdoor wear?
While designed for added warmth, their suitability for outdoor wear depends on specific weather conditions. They offer sufficient protection in dry, moderately cold climates. However, they are not recommended for wet, snowy, or icy conditions due to limited traction and water resistance.
Question 2: How should lined clogs be cleaned?
The exterior can be cleaned with a damp cloth. The lining requires spot cleaning with mild detergent and cool water. Avoid submerging the footwear and allow it to air dry completely.
Question 3: Do lined clogs offer adequate foot support?
They generally provide similar support to classic clogs. While the lining enhances comfort, it does not significantly alter the structural support offered. Individuals requiring substantial arch support may need to consider additional orthotic inserts.
Question 4: Are lined clogs true to size?
Sizing recommendations typically align with standard clog sizing. However, consulting specific brand size charts is advisable, as the lining may marginally influence fit. Trying the footwear on before purchase, when possible, is always recommended.
Question 5: How durable is the faux fur lining?
Durability varies depending on the quality of the faux fur and manufacturing process. Generally, the lining is designed to withstand regular wear. However, excessive friction or exposure to harsh conditions may accelerate wear and tear. Following care instructions can help prolong the lining’s lifespan.
Question 6: Are lined clogs suitable for all seasons?
The added warmth of the lining makes them less suitable for hot summer months. They are ideally suited for cooler temperatures, extending the wearability of clogs into spring, autumn, and milder winter conditions. Individual comfort levels may vary depending on climate and personal preference.
